首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在SAS中使用宏生成Union语句

是一种常见的数据处理技术,它可以帮助我们简化代码并提高效率。下面是关于这个问题的完善且全面的答案:

概念: 在SAS中,宏是一种用于生成和执行代码片段的工具。宏可以接受参数,并根据参数的不同生成不同的代码。使用宏可以减少代码的重复性,提高代码的可维护性和可读性。

Union语句是一种用于合并多个数据集的SQL语句。它将多个数据集的行按照列的顺序合并在一起,生成一个包含所有数据的新数据集。

分类: 在SAS中,宏可以分为两种类型:全局宏和局部宏。全局宏可以在整个SAS程序中使用,而局部宏只能在定义它的程序块中使用。

优势: 使用宏生成Union语句的优势包括:

  1. 代码重用:通过使用宏,我们可以将Union语句的生成逻辑封装在一个宏中,以便在需要时重复使用。
  2. 灵活性:宏可以接受参数,根据参数的不同生成不同的Union语句,从而满足不同的需求。
  3. 代码简洁:使用宏可以减少代码的重复性,提高代码的可读性和可维护性。

应用场景: 在以下情况下,使用宏生成Union语句特别有用:

  1. 需要合并多个数据集,并且数据集的结构相似。
  2. 需要根据不同的条件生成不同的Union语句。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与云计算相关的产品和服务,包括云服务器、云数据库、云存储等。这些产品可以帮助用户快速构建和部署云计算解决方案。

以下是腾讯云相关产品的介绍链接地址:

  1. 腾讯云服务器(CVM):https://cloud.tencent.com/product/cvm
  2. 腾讯云数据库(TencentDB):https://cloud.tencent.com/product/cdb
  3. 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os

请注意,以上链接仅供参考,具体的产品选择应根据实际需求进行评估和决策。

总结: 在SAS中使用宏生成Union语句是一种常见的数据处理技术,它可以通过减少代码重复性、提高代码灵活性和简洁性来提高工作效率。腾讯云提供了一系列与云计算相关的产品和服务,可以帮助用户构建和部署云计算解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分29秒

MySQL系列七之任务1【导入SQL文件,生成表格数据】

10分30秒

053.go的error入门

7分15秒

mybatis框架入门必备教程-041-MyBatis-实体类封装数据返回的意义

6分11秒

mybatis框架入门必备教程-043-MyBatis-按主键查学生mapper.xml实现

8分10秒

mybatis框架入门必备教程-045-MyBatis-完成模糊查询

6分16秒

mybatis框架入门必备教程-040-MyBatis-测试功能

1分51秒

mybatis框架入门必备教程-042-MyBatis-namespace的意义

6分41秒

mybatis框架入门必备教程-044-MyBatis-按主键查学生测试

4分11秒

05、mysql系列之命令、快捷窗口的使用

2分14秒

03-stablediffusion模型原理-12-SD模型的应用场景

5分24秒

03-stablediffusion模型原理-11-SD模型的处理流程

3分27秒

03-stablediffusion模型原理-10-VAE模型

领券